The research tells us that exclusively breastfed babies take in an average of 25 oz (750 mL) per day between the ages of 1 month and 6 months. Different babies take in different amounts of milk; a typical range of milk intakes is 19-30 oz per day (570-900 mL per day). Expressing milk takes practice. You are training your body to respond to your hands or a pump like it does to your baby. In general, your baby is better at removing your milk than a pump or hand expression will be. At first, you will probably be able to express small amounts. For most moms, this gradually increases as time goes on.

The first few days, before mom's milk comes in, hand expression is often the most effective way to express colostrum. Double pump for 10-15 minutes per session for additional stimulation. Once mom's milk is in, pump for 30 minutes per session, or for 2-5 minutes after the last drops of milk. If baby nurses but does not soften the breast well

Hand expressing breast milk is a helpful technique when breast pumps are unavailable or inconvenient, and can also help with engorged breasts or milk supply issues. To hand express, use a C-shaped grip with fingers and thumb, gently pressing and rolling motions to encourage milk flow, while moving your hand around your breast to empty all ducts.
